Requirements

• Must be 16 years of age or older

• Must have valid lifeguard safety certifications/CPR/First Aid/or in the process of obtaining the certifications. 

• Must be available to work weekends and holidays

 

Physical Demands

• Must be able to perform the basic life operational functions of climbing, balancing, stooping, kneeling, crouching, crawling, reaching, standing, walking, pushing, pulling, lifting, fingering, grasping, feeling, talking, hearing, and swimming. 

• Must be able to swim 50 yards in 4 ft. of water and retrieve a 10 lb. brick from the bottom of the pool.

• Must be able to work in warm, humid environments for extended periods of time. 

• Must be able to perform medium work exerting up to 50 pounds of force occasionally, and/or 20 pounds frequently. 

• Must possess auditory, verbal, and visual capabilities to adequately communicate to staff and guests.  Special Requirement Must be flexible and able to work day, evening, weekend, and holiday shifts.

Key Responsibilities:

• Supervises swimming activities at the facility and ensures that policies, guidelines, and safety procedures are followed

• Warns swimmers of improper activities or danger and enforces pool regulations and water safety policies

• Administers first aid in the event of injury, rescues swimmers in distress or danger of drowning, and administers CPR and/or artificial respiration, if necessary

• Evaluates conditions for safety and initiates aquatics emergency action plan as required

• Inspects pool facilities, equipment, and water to ensure that they are safe and usable

• Supervises and assists in cleaning the pool, related facilities and equipment.

• Instructs or assists classes in fundamentals of swimming as needed

• Resolves conflicts to ensure a safe pool environment
